Cassandra Sims, LISW-CP, is dedicated to helping adults in South Carolina navigate life’s challenges with evidence-based therapeutic support. She works with individuals facing anxiety, depression, PTSD, and later life transitions, providing compassionate guidance tailored to each client’s needs. With decades of experience in community mental health, Cassandra understands the complexities of emotional wellness and strives to empower individuals through practical coping strategies and mindfulness techniques. Cassandra is particularly passionate about supporting individuals experiencing grief, ob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D), and hoarding behaviors. She helps clients process loss, develop healthier thought patterns, and create structured approaches to managing overwhelming situations. By integrating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) skills with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), she equips clients with the tools necessary to foster resilience and personal growth. In addition to individual therapy, Cassandra offers couples counseling, helping partners navigate communication barriers, relationship stress, and emotional disconnection. Her client-centered approach focuses on fostering understanding and strengthening relational bonds. She also serves military veterans and first responders, recognizing the unique mental health challenges faced by these populations and providing tailored support to enhance overall well-being. A South Carolina native, Cassandra has been practicing since 1979 and brings a wealth of experience from both community and private practice settings.
